The situation this course is for

Even well-structured acquisitions fail to deliver value when leadership lacks a shared operating model. Without clear decision rights, aligned technology roadmaps, and consistent risk governance, teams default to siloed responses, slowing integration and increasing operational drift. The cost isn't just financial, it's strategic momentum.
